我用python开发了fuse fs,现在想写testing。 在testing之前,我将fs安装到一些目录中:
fs = MyFuseFS() fs.parse(errex=1, ['some_dir']) fs.main()
经过testing,我想卸载我的FS,想要做这样的事情:
fs.unmount()
这是像“卸载”的方法吗? 也许有另一种方法来卸载FS?
http://packages.python.org/fs/expose/fuse.html
你可以从这个链接看到你需要什么。
>>> from fs.memoryfs import MemoryFS >>> from fs.expose import fuse >>> fs = MemoryFS() >>> mp = fuse.mount(fs,"/mnt/my-memory-fs") >>> mp.unmount()
你猜对了函数名:)